This is my J.C. named Steggy. I've had him for a few months now.
He's used to it now but still isn't 100% on me picking him up. Which I don't blame him. I'd be pissed if a human had to handle me too. But, he doesn't turn black anymore so that's great.
Today though, I made a discovery. Chameleons don't like other chameleons. Like... Really don't! I've read it before that they don't do well in groups anyway. Not really a pack type breed. Well today I was doing some work on his home and had him sitting on my shoulder. Walked across my apartment and felt Steggy start jerking around. I looked at him and saw him staring at himself in a mirror in my dining room. He was within' inches. Head kept jerking up and he got all puffed up. I thought he was about to throw his tongue out at himself! Once he started turning a yellow/orange color, I began to walk away from the mirror. Put him back in his home and he perched up on a vine.
